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Daurian Hedgehog | Ruddy Shelduck |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Erinaceomorpha (Erinaceomorpha) | Anseriformes (Anseriformes) |
| Family | Erinaceidae | Anatidae |
| Genus | Mesechinus | Tadorna |
| Species | Mesechinus dauuricus | Tadorna ferruginea |
Evolutionary Relationship
Daurian Hedgehog and Ruddy Shelduck share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
